Interventions
BEHAVIORAL

Parent Activation

Parent Activation (PA) is comprised of concrete social learning theory steps (i.e., direct instruction, modeling, practice opportunities, and reinforcement) that aim to enhance a parent's confidence, knowledge, and ability to manage his/her child's health. PA is applicable across a range of conditions, including behavioral and psychiatric problems, and it can be delivered by varied providers, including paraprofessionals.

BEHAVIORAL

Usual Services

This intervention refers to the typical techniques that JPOs employ to monitor the juveniles on their caseloads (e.g., regular meetings with youth and parents to ensure the youth is following conditions of probation and issuing swift sanctions \[community service; detention\] if conditions are not being followed).
